About the Role
We are looking for a highly motivated GNSS Signal Processing Engineer to join our team at VyomIC , where we are building the next-generation Global LEO- PNT(Positioning, Navigation, and Timing) satellite constellation from India.
In this role, you will design, simulate, test, and optimize innovative LEO-PNT signals , ensuring global precision, robustness, and resilience. You will work at the intersection of signal design, system engineering, and performance validation , contributing to the core architecture of VyomIC’s constellation.
Key Responsibilities
- Design and develop advanced GNSS/PNT signal structures tailored for LEO satellites .
- Perform simulation and analysis of signal performance under multipath, interference, and jamming conditions to assess robustness of the signal.
- Validate signal acquisition, tracking, and decoding algorithms for the designed signal architecture and Optimize it for Interoperability.
- Collaborate with hardware, mission design, and GNSS team to ensure seamless integration of signal design into payload and receiver platforms.
- Support prototype implementation and testing , including software receivers, SDRs, and hardware-in-the-loop setups.
- Stay updated with the latest global GNSS and LEO-PNT advancements , standards, and regulatory requirements.
Required Skills & Experience
- Robust background in digital communications, spread spectrum systems, and signal processing .
- Hands-on experience with GNSS signals (GPS, Galileo, NavIC, etc.) , including acquisition and tracking.
- Proficiency in MATLAB, Python, or C/C++ for simulation and algorithm development.
- Solid understanding of modulation schemes (BPSK, BOC, QPSK, etc.) and coding techniques (e.g., BCH, LDPC ).
- Experience with link budget analysis and performance metrics.
- Familiarity with simulation tools (MATLAB/Simulink, GNU Radio, etc.).
